Make your own ringtone!

To make a ring tone, you need a program called Mix craft.

You can Google for this and download it free.

Once you have downloaded it, you need to install it.

After installing, open the program.

Some phones support MP3 ring tones, while others only support MIDI ring tones.

MIDI supported cell-phone users read below:

  1. When you open Mix craft, choose Build Virtual Instrument Tracks
  2. Choose an instrument you want to be used in your ring tone (MIDI ring tones don’t work with songs)
  3. Use they piano keys to make and record your own song
  4. Once you have a song, click on file and select save as MIDI file.
  5. Put the Midi file in your cell phone’s ring tone folder, and you have a polyphonic ring tone!

MP3 supported cell-phone users read below:

  1. Find a song that you like
  2. Open mix craft, and select cancel when it gives you the three choices for making a song.
  3. Go to mix, then select add sound
  4. Find your song and select it
  5. Choose a certain part of your song by left-clicking and dragging the mouse
  6. Right-click and select copy
  7. Open a new mix craft, and paste your song onto the audio track bar.
  8. Go to File, choose Save as and save your ring tone
  9. Put the MP3 file in your cell phone’s ring tone folder, and you have a MP3 ring tone!
